Ingredients of Oats energy bar….
- Prepare of Oats 150gm, honey1tbsp, jaggery 50gm, peanut butter2tbsp, little salt, dry fruits as u wish like almonds,walnuts,kaju,raisins,figs, dates etc.

Oats energy bar…. step by step
- Roast dry oats till it truns little brown.
- Remove oats and add crushed jaggerry, melt it.
- Then add peanut butter 2tbs, and all dry fruits,dates without seeds,and also cut the figs..
- Now add little salt and saute.
- Then add roasted oats and saute…it will trun little hard…make a nice mix..
- In a big plate apply some peanut butter for greasing and pour all batter, spread it, and press it through the steell flat surface of bowl., make a thin layer and cut it in two bars…hot only..and your healthy oats energy bars are ready to eat..
